    This review covers three visits, the first two were midweek in 2025 and one two weeks ago on a…read moreFriday. It's an interesting setup, as there's a separate space for Pico and a space for Lumen Wines, however we were told that the wine tastings are done in the restaurant. The ambiance is upscale-casual, the service is excellent (thanks Kali for getting my joke and making me laugh on our last visit), and the food is wonderfully delicious. They have main floor seating, a balcony, and a back patio, so request your spot when making a reservation. DRINKS: They have a full bar and the cocktails we've tried were very well made. The wine list is primarily Lumen wines, but there are some other local and old-world wines available, and some alcohol-free cocktails and beer too. On our first visit, we tried a Lumen wine tasting flight consisting of a '21 Chardonnay, a '21 Pinot Noir, and a '21 Grenache, and a couple extra pours, like the Escence orange wine and the "Hey Ginger" Pet Nat (check out my separate review for Lumen Wines). FOOD: We've eaten something on all three visits and everything we've tried has been very good. The menu is seasonal, so it's ever changing. The appetizers/entrées we've tried are the Wedge Salad, Kabocha Salad, Grilled Carrots, Avocado Crudo, Channel Island Squid, Steak Tartare, Pico Burger, and Rabbit Carnitas Tostadas. The food is well-seasoned and prepared as ordered. The kitchen seems to work well with the wait staff to coordinate when courses are delivered, so you're not getting everything at once. Pico is one of our favorite spots in the Los Alamos/Los Olivos/Buellton area and well worth the drive if you're not staying right nearby. I highly recommend you check them out.
